Output 42afb37d1e639e119c8521adbb94c1801864992b24bd33fb0b3eb7a80d73c63b:1

value
5256
script pubkey
OP_0 OP_PUSHBYTES_20 95f0a9e9f3e5ec4d497a8e4e24de62bd5562de63
address
bc1qjhc2n60nuhky6jt63e8zfhnzh42k9hnr0q40t7
transaction
42afb37d1e639e119c8521adbb94c1801864992b24bd33fb0b3eb7a80d73c63b
confirmations
55465
spent
true